Output d26543283511fe8ed1364176d9dfa67c87e5b90c8c268ee161bbe38e4f88229d:0

value
430044913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c561b9ab1c9735bf5e74bb3a16323747863b5bd4 OP_EQUAL
address
MRtpRHrUCoD1ZznoZF9QPvw8qRGhRjZriK
transaction
d26543283511fe8ed1364176d9dfa67c87e5b90c8c268ee161bbe38e4f88229d
spent
true